Reverend aged in a French Oak Opus One Barrel with Bretts and House Sour Blend #2.

On tap at Avery. Poured hazy brown with garnet highlight and an effervescent amber foam. Aromas of barnyard and brett funk, sour grapes, cherry Jolly Rancher candy, baseball glove, some oak and soft spice. Palate was clean and crisp with a puckering tartness. Flavors of horse blanket, oak, slight vanilla, tobacco, dark grapes, sour candy, burnt sugar, light spice with a crisp lingering dry tart funky finish. Amazing brew.
